SEEK is a 5-day conference, held in Indianapolis in 2019, meant to help you grow in your Catholic faith. It will feature talks by world famous Catholic speakers, Mass, Adoration with over 15,000 people, and a concert by Needtobreathe. Two years ago 27 Harvard students attended; our goal for 2019 is to beat that! The FOCUS missionaries have set-up fun and friendly benchmarks to get more and more students to sign up...stay tuned. Join a unique tutoring/mentoring program that has partnered with Cambridge/Boston area college students since 1985. EVkids pairs college tutors with inner city youth for weekly tutoring. Harvard Catholic students...you
